Description
The University of Southampton is looking to contract out the very successful and award winning ICURe Programme (Innovation & Commercialisation of University Research). It is into its sixth year of instilling innovation and commercialisation awareness into research groups in universities throughout the UK ( www.icure.uk ). ICURe gets researchers 'out of the lab and into the marketplace' to identify and validate the market opportunities for their research results. ICURe helps to break through the barriers that keep the potentially world changing research knowledge 'bottled up' for so many university research groups.
The ICURe Programme operates on the same principles, that it 'preaches' to the university researchers going through ICURe, of keeping ICURe innovative, responsive, flexible and lean. Therefore, ICURe relies heavily on a significant number of independent individuals to deliver many of the key elements of the ICURe Programme.
The ICURe Programme is a key element of the UKRI commercialisation strategy with its funding coming annually via Innovate UK. This annualised funding has been a key factor in structuring the Programme to rely heavily on experienced and innovative individuals that are engaged to deliver key elements of the Programme on an 'as required' basis during the year. The year on year funding also makes it very difficult to employ people, as job security is not currently possible. The nature of the ICURe Programme, running in approximately 3-month long cohorts with differing capability requirements at various times during each of the cohorts, also dictates that specific capabilities are only required occasionally.
